Hip knee ankle foot orthosis a hip knee ankle foot orthosis hkafo is an orthosis whose components stabilize or lock the hip, knee and ankle the typical hkafo is a pair of kafos linked above the hip with either a pelvic band, lumbosacral orthosis the hip section provides significant stability in the transverse plane and, if the hip joints are locked, also provides sagittal plane stability.
